#53f165 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53f165 is composed of 32.5% red, 94.5%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.1%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 126.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 63.5%. #53f165 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ffca with #00e300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#53f165 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53f165 has RGB values of R:83, G:241,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5501285.

Shades and Tints of #53f165
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010902 is the darkest color, while #f6f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#53f165
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a2a2 is the less saturated color, while #4cf85f is the most saturated one.
